Looking for inspiration?

Some ideas on how to inject your character and personalities into your session.

I’ve wandered the streets of Paris with a chic couple that made the city their home. Of course we took in the sights with some gorgeous shots in front of the Eiffel Tower, but some of my favourite photos were taken whilst wandering around the backstreets of Paris and exploring the city with a couple who met and fell in love there.
Annie and Ed got down to earth when they took off their shoes and climbed a tree together (which made some amazingly fun shots).
Chris and Georgie went punting on the Thames, which is one of their favourite ways to spend a weekend. This tied into the theme of their wedding at the Cherwell Boathouse, where guests got to try out punting for themselves
Rachel and Timm couple took a sunset ride on a tandem bicycle that the groom to be lovingly restored for the wedding. Timm is a bicycle enthusiast so a tandem bicycle was the perfect way to celebrate their engagement in a very personal way.
